Buffalo Gap was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their fifth straight defeat. They were dealt a 72-36 loss at the hands of the Riverheads Gladiators. The Bison were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Gladiators ap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in February of 2024.
Buffalo Gap's loss dropped their record down to 4-7. As for Riverheads, their win bumped their record up to 9-7.
Buffalo Gap will welcome Staunton at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. One thing working in Staunton's favor is that they have posted at least 55 points in their last seven games. As for Riverheads, they will venture away from home to face off against Fort Defiance at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
